8,730,492 (eight million seven hundred thirty thousand four hundred ninety-two) is an even 7-digit number. It is a composite number with 12 divisors, and factors as 2² × 3 × 727,541. Its proper divisors sum to 11,640,684, more than the number itself, making it an abundant number.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x85377C.

Goldbach decomposition

Goldbach's conjecture says every even integer greater than 2 is the sum of two primes. For 8730492, here are decompositions:

  • 5 + 8730487 = 8730492
  • 19 + 8730473 = 8730492
  • 139 + 8730353 = 8730492
  • 149 + 8730343 = 8730492
  • 151 + 8730341 = 8730492
  • 181 + 8730311 = 8730492
  • 223 + 8730269 = 8730492
  • 229 + 8730263 = 8730492

Showing the first eight; more decompositions exist.
